This new strategic focus on sustainability is being driven by a perfect storm of forces: rising energy costs, global concern about climate change, the world's biggest companies pressuring suppliers to go green, and new "stakeholders" like NGOs and activist shareholders asking very tough questions about how companies handle environmental and social issues.

Andrew Winston will set the stage for focusing on eco-innovation as a driver of competitive advantage, describing the rationale behind the four pillars of innovation:
- Cost Savings
- Revenue Growth
- Intangible Brand Benefit
- Risk Mitigation
